Market Summary

  • The thermoplastic polyurethane market is defined by its role as a versatile, high-performance polymer bridging the gap between rigid plastics and flexible rubbers. Growth is fueled by strong demand from the automotive and footwear industries, where its superior abrasion resistance, elasticity, and durability are critical for producing lightweight components and high-comfort products.
  • A primary trend shaping the market is the pivot toward sustainability, with significant research and development focused on bio-based thermoplastic polyurethane derived from renewable resources. This shift not only reduces dependence on petrochemicals but also aligns with corporate environmental, social, and governance mandates.
  • However, the industry navigates challenges related to raw material price volatility, which is tied to fluctuating crude oil prices.

By Application Insights

The footwear segment is estimated to witness significant growth during the forecast period.

The footwear sector's adoption of thermoplastic polyurethane continues to expand, driven by demand for lightweight midsoles, durable electronic casings, and high-grip outsoles that utilize advanced material engineering over conventional materials.

The shift toward sustainable polymer development is pronounced, with manufacturers leveraging high-performance polymers for their superior abrasion resistance and design flexibility. Innovations in supercritical fluid foaming enable the creation of midsoles that are up to 20% lighter while improving rebound.

The material's compatibility with extrusion technology and injection molding supports high-volume production of athletic and safety footwear, where long-term compression stability and low-temperature flexibility are critical.

This transition is further supported by the mechanical recycling process, which aligns with circular economy solutions and addresses consumer demand for recyclable thermoplastic materials in modern footwear.

The geographic landscape of the thermoplastic polyurethane market is led by the APAC region, which accounts for 35.7% of the market's incremental growth, solidifying its position as the primary hub for both production and consumption.

This dominance is driven by rapid industrialization and robust manufacturing sectors in countries like China and India, particularly in automotive and footwear applications.

Optimized production lines in this region have enabled a 10% reduction in processing cycle times for high-volume components.

In contrast, North America and Europe function as mature markets focused on innovation in high-value segments, such as medical-grade tpu and bio-based tpu.

These regions prioritize sustainable polymer development and advanced material engineering, driving demand for specialized formulations like polyester-based tpu with superior chemical resistant coatings and abrasion resistance.

What challenges does the Thermoplastic Polyurethane Industry face during its growth?

  • A key challenge affecting industry growth is the susceptibility of certain thermoplastic polyurethane grades to structural damage caused by moisture.

  • The thermoplastic polyurethane market faces operational and economic challenges that temper its growth trajectory. The susceptibility of polyester-based tpu to hydrolysis, or moisture damage, remains a significant technical hurdle, requiring the development of formulations with improved hydrolysis resistance.
  • From a financial perspective, the fluctuation in raw material prices, tied to volatile petrochemical markets, can cause production cost variances of up to 25% quarter-over-quarter. This volatility complicates strategic planning and margin control. Additionally, stringent safety and environmental legislation governing the production of these thermoplastic elastomers adds another layer of complexity.
  • Compliance with these regulations can increase operational overhead by 10% due to mandatory investments in monitoring systems and advanced safety equipment, impacting overall profitability.

Recent Development and News in Thermoplastic polyurethane market

  • In June, 2025, Covestro announced its Desmopan FLY technology, a next-generation thermoplastic polyurethane grade optimized for supercritical fluid foaming, had entered scaled production for international footwear customers.
  • In June, 2025, BASF announced the commercialization of its new Polycaprolactone-based thermoplastic polyurethane for medical tubing, implantable components, and biodegradable wearable devices.
  • In March, 2025, BASF announced the launch of its Elastollan E TPU series, specifically engineered for electronic device housings and protective casings that require excellent scratch resistance, chemical stability, and shock absorption.
  • In February, 2025, Covestro announced the commercialization of its Bayflex TPU series for automotive interior and exterior applications, emphasizing its use in flexible gaskets, cable coatings, and soft-touch dashboard components.
